  • The Advantages And Applications Of Linear Electrical Actuators

    linear electrical actuators are devices that convert electrical energy into mechanical motion in a straight line. They are commonly used in a variety of applications, including robotics, automotive systems, industrial machinery, and aerospace technology. In this article, we will explore the advantages of linear electrical actuators and discuss some of the ways in which they are used in different industries.

    One of the primary advantages of linear electrical actuators is their precision and accuracy. Unlike hydraulic or pneumatic actuators, which rely on fluid dynamics to generate motion, linear electrical actuators use electric motors to control the movement of a load along a linear path. This allows for more precise positioning and control, making them ideal for applications that require high levels of accuracy, such as in robotics and automation systems.

    Another key advantage of linear electrical actuators is their versatility. They can be easily integrated into existing control systems, making them suitable for a wide range of applications. They can also be customized to meet specific performance requirements, such as speed, force, and stroke length, making them a flexible option for designers and engineers.

    linear electrical actuators are also known for their efficiency and reliability. Unlike traditional pneumatic systems, which can be prone to leaks and failures, linear electrical actuators operate using electrical power, which is more predictable and consistent. This results in higher levels of efficiency and uptime, making them a cost-effective solution for many industries.

    In addition to their precision and reliability, linear electrical actuators offer a number of other advantages. They are compact and lightweight, making them easy to install and integrate into existing systems. They also produce minimal noise and vibration, making them suitable for applications where noise levels need to be kept to a minimum.

    One of the most common applications of linear electrical actuators is in robotics. They are used to control the movement of robotic arms, grippers, and other components, allowing robots to perform a wide range of tasks with speed and precision. linear electrical actuators are also used in industrial machinery, such as conveyor systems, packaging equipment, and material handling systems, where precise positioning and control are essential.

    In the automotive industry, linear electrical actuators are used in a variety of applications, including power windows, seat adjusters, and door locks. They offer fast and precise movement, making them ideal for applications where speed and accuracy are critical. Linear electrical actuators are also used in aerospace technology, where they are used in aircraft control surfaces, landing gear, and other critical systems that require precise control and reliability.

  • The Cost Of DNA Testing During Pregnancy: What You Need To Know

    DNA testing during pregnancy can provide valuable information about the health and well-being of the baby Whether you are considering genetic testing for medical reasons or simply want to learn more about your baby’s genetic makeup, it’s important to understand the costs associated with these tests.

    There are several different types of DNA tests that can be done during pregnancy, each with its own set of costs Some of the most common types of tests include non-invasive prenatal testing (NIPT), amniocentesis, and chorionic villus sampling (CVS) Each of these tests has different levels of accuracy and some are more invasive than others.

    Non-invasive prenatal testing (NIPT) is a simple blood test that can be done as early as 10 weeks gestation This test is often used to screen for certain genetic conditions, such as Down syndrome, trisomy 18, and trisomy 13 NIPT is a relatively low-cost option compared to other types of DNA testing during pregnancy, with prices ranging from $500 to $1,500.

    Amniocentesis is a more invasive test that involves collecting a sample of amniotic fluid from the sac surrounding the baby This test is usually done between 15 and 20 weeks gestation and can provide more detailed information about the baby’s genetic makeup The cost of amniocentesis can range from $1,500 to $3,000, depending on the location and provider.

    Chorionic villus sampling (CVS) is another invasive test that involves taking a sample of cells from the placenta This test is usually done between 10 and 13 weeks gestation and can also provide detailed information about the baby’s genetic makeup The cost of CVS can range from $1,000 to $2,500.

    It’s important to note that these costs are just estimates and can vary depending on the provider, location, and any additional fees that may be included Some insurance plans may cover all or part of the cost of DNA testing during pregnancy, so it’s worth checking with your provider to see what is covered.

  • Understanding The Power Of A Tolomatic Actuator

    When it comes to automation and motion control, the tolomatic actuator is a key player in the field. These devices are essential in a wide range of industries, including manufacturing, automotive, aerospace, and more. In this article, we will take a closer look at what a tolomatic actuator is, how it works, and its applications in various industries.

    A tolomatic actuator is a type of linear motion device that converts rotary motion into linear motion. It consists of a motor, ball screw, and housing, which work together to move a load in a straight line. The motor provides the power to drive the ball screw, which in turn moves the load along the axis of the actuator. The housing encloses and protects the internal components of the actuator.

    One of the key features of a Tolomatic actuator is its precision and accuracy. These devices are designed to provide smooth and consistent motion, making them ideal for applications that require high levels of control and repeatability. They are capable of handling heavy loads while maintaining fast speeds and precise positioning, making them a versatile choice for a wide range of industrial applications.

    Tolomatic actuators come in a variety of configurations, including rodless, rod-style, and guided actuators. Rodless actuators are ideal for applications where space is limited, as they do not have a protruding rod. Rod-style actuators are more traditional, with a rod that extends and retracts from the housing. Guided actuators are designed to provide additional support and stability for heavy loads or applications that require precise alignment.

    The versatility of Tolomatic actuators makes them suitable for a wide range of applications in various industries. In the manufacturing sector, these devices are used in assembly lines, packaging machinery, and material handling systems. They are also commonly found in automotive assembly plants, where they are used to move car parts and components along the production line.

    In the aerospace industry, Tolomatic actuators are used in aircraft manufacturing and maintenance. These devices are essential for operating a variety of systems, including landing gear, flaps, and cargo doors. They are also used in robotic arms and motion control systems for precision tasks such as welding, painting, and inspection.

    Tolomatic actuators are also widely used in the medical industry for applications such as hospital beds, surgical tables, and diagnostic equipment. These devices provide precise control and positioning for medical devices, ensuring the safety and comfort of patients during procedures. In the field of robotics, Tolomatic actuators are essential for creating motion control systems that can perform complex tasks with speed and precision.

  • The Impact Of Section 21 On Tenants And Landlords

    In the world of renting properties in the United Kingdom, Section 21 has been a hot topic of debate and contention for both tenants and landlords The infamous Section 21 is a clause in the Housing Act 1988 that allows landlords to evict tenants without having to provide a reason, as long as they have given the required notice period This provision has been at the center of many disputes and discussions, with advocates arguing for its necessity in protecting landlords’ interests and opponents criticizing it for its impact on tenants’ security and stability.

    One of the main issues with Section 21 is the lack of security it provides for tenants Tenants living in properties where landlords have the power to evict them at any time without justification often feel vulnerable and powerless This insecurity can lead to high levels of stress and anxiety, as tenants are constantly worried about being forced to leave their homes with very little notice For families and individuals who rely on stable housing to maintain their livelihoods, Section 21 can be a major source of instability and uncertainty.

    Furthermore, Section 21 has been criticized for enabling retaliatory evictions In some cases, tenants who raise concerns about the condition of their property or request repairs may find themselves facing eviction shortly after This creates a chilling effect where tenants are afraid to assert their rights or speak up about issues for fear of losing their homes As a result, many tenants feel trapped in substandard living conditions, unable to advocate for themselves without risking their housing security.

    On the other hand, landlords argue that Section 21 is necessary to protect their property rights and ensure that they can regain possession of their properties in a timely manner Without the ability to evict tenants efficiently, landlords may struggle to manage their rental properties effectively and address issues such as non-payment of rent or property damage From the landlord’s perspective, Section 21 provides a crucial safety net that allows them to take action when tenants breach their rental agreements or fail to uphold their responsibilities.

  • The Ultimate Guide To Iveco Daily Conversion

    Iveco Daily is a popular choice for converting into campervans, mobile homes, and other types of utility vehicles With its robust build, spacious interior, and reliable engine, the Iveco Daily is perfect for turning into the ultimate customized vehicle for any purpose In this article, we will explore the different aspects of Iveco Daily conversion, from design and layout to insulation and electrical systems.

    Design and Layout
    One of the first steps in converting an Iveco Daily into a camper or mobile home is to plan out the design and layout of the interior The spacious interior of the Iveco Daily allows for ample customization options, including sleeping areas, kitchenettes, dining spaces, and storage compartments Many conversion companies offer pre-designed layouts for Iveco Daily conversions, making it easy for DIY enthusiasts to create their dream vehicle.

    When planning the design and layout of an Iveco Daily conversion, it is important to consider the specific needs and preferences of the owner For example, if the conversion is intended for long-term travel, a comfortable sleeping area and functional kitchenette may be a priority On the other hand, if the conversion is intended for off-grid living, solar panels and a composting toilet may be essential additions.

    Insulation
    Proper insulation is crucial for ensuring a comfortable living environment in an Iveco Daily conversion, especially during extreme weather conditions Insulation helps regulate temperature, reduces noise, and prevents condensation buildup inside the vehicle There are several types of insulation materials available for Iveco Daily conversions, including fiberglass, foam boards, and reflective insulation.

    When insulating an Iveco Daily conversion, it is important to pay attention to all areas of the vehicle, including walls, ceiling, floor, and windows Properly insulating the vehicle can significantly improve energy efficiency and reduce heating and cooling costs iveco daily conversion. Additionally, insulating the vehicle also helps protect the interior from moisture and mold growth.

    Electrical Systems
    A well-designed electrical system is essential for powering appliances, lights, and other electrical devices in an Iveco Daily conversion The electrical system of an Iveco Daily conversion typically includes a leisure battery, solar panels, inverter, charger, and wiring It is important to design the electrical system in such a way that it is safe, reliable, and easy to maintain.

    Solar panels are a popular choice for powering electrical devices in Iveco Daily conversions, as they are environmentally friendly and cost-effective Solar panels can be mounted on the roof of the vehicle and connected to a leisure battery using a charge controller Inverters are used to convert the DC power generated by the solar panels into AC power, which can be used to power appliances and devices.
